In this special episode, Dan interviews Certified Nutritional Consultant and Certified Neuronutrient Therapy Specialist Karla Maree. Karla specializes in brain chemistry and for 13 years was a staff clinician of Julia Ross, author of The Mood Cure and others. Her fifteen years of practice has a special emphasis on correcting the brain’s neurotransmitter functioning. She helps clients rejuvenate their health by focusing on key areas such as nutrient deficiencies and dietary imbalances as well as identifying and eliminating the instigators of debilitating health challenges. She works with depression, anxiety, weight normalization, dysbiosis, thyroid, adrenal, sex hormone, sleep, as well as celiac disease and other autoimmune conditions.
